What Does “Failure to Maintain Lane” Mean in South Carolina?

This charge typically comes up when an officer sees a vehicle:

  • Swerving across lane lines
  • Driving onto the shoulder
  • Failing to stay centered in their lane
  • Drifting between lanes without signaling

But what the law says and what really happened aren’t always the same thing. Officers often don’t take into account:

  • Road conditions (wet pavement, narrow lanes, construction)
  • Obstacles (potholes, debris, disabled vehicles)
  • Driver avoidance (swerve to avoid a crash or hazard)
  • Medical conditions or mechanical issues

The Real Impact of a Lane Violation

This isn’t just about 4 points on your license.

Failure to maintain lane can lead to:

  • License suspension if you’ve had other recent violations
  • Insurance rate increases that cost you thousands over time
  • Complications in accident liability, even if you weren’t at fault
  • Job loss if you drive for work, hold a CDL, or are required to maintain a clean record
